Union Public Service Commission (UPSC)

UPSC

The Union of Public Service Commission popularly knows as UPSC was accorded a constitutional status as an autonomous entity in the new constitution on 26th January 1950.

One of the major functions of the Commission is recruitment to services & posts under the Union through conduct of competitive examinations. The Commission usually conducts a number of examinations every year on an all India basis, for direct recruitment in various fields, such as, Civil Services, Engineering, Medical and Forest Service, etc.

Examinations conducted by UPSC

Civil Services

Indian Forest Service

Indian Engineering Services

Indian Economic Service / Indian Statistical Service

Geologist Examination

Special Class Railway Apprentices

National Defence Academy and Naval Academy

Combined Defence Services

Combined Medical Services

Section Officers/Stenographers

Central Police Force

The plan of examinations usually includes, preliminary, and/or main examination followed by an interview for personality test.

The application form is common for all the examinations but the eligibility conditions and other details may vary. Also, one has to submit separate forms if he/she wants to appear in more than one examination.
